Well, I think you have a pest problem but on top of that, I think you white powdery mildew. Attached is a pic of it.
Looks like you have white powdery mildew to me. There are a bunch of different ways to get rid of it, I've had good success using a 1:9 milk/water mix, neem oil spray, and Dr zymes. Dr Zymes has seemed to work best and helps with other molds and pests too however its more expensive than the other two. I get this every season where I live, so since the first season I regularly spray Dr. Zymes on all my Outdoor plants once they get a few weeks into veg.
